@ Pallo - no chips for me today?! 🤔 Meyer for a Meyer is always welcome man - he's one of my favorites! I'm pretty much in agreement with all you said - special shout out to Gulaal's measuring meter - haila! 500KG! What does she want to make out of our Kesar?! 😲

In reference to this one line: It throws light that he totally understands Gulaal's way of looking at things.
I have to disagree slightly. I personally think he's coming around much faster than we would expect him too - which is exponentially faster than Gulaal - who's advancement in the field of revelations is currently o the negative side of the scale - but I'm not giving Kesar 10/10 yet. He still has confusions over being wrong in love because he's younger. Which - whoever else may have issues with it - is not Gulaal's real problem. Her real problem is only and all about Vasant. Kesar could have been a decade older than her, for all she cared, and he would still have her stubborn no for an answer. (Of course if he means he's being physically manhandled, and repeatedly told off like a 12 year old still, yeh, that would probably be avoided if he was older). But my point is, he's getting there - everyone is talking about the mandir, but I think his revelation on how Gulaal had to be brought back to this house because it is the only way she can ever be happy, again was another deep understanding. Goes on to explain, that even beneath is lose it phases and frantic tantrums, he wasn't just harping about his love, but her happiness, not just with him, as he desperately wants, but with this house she belongs to! Yet, hes not there yet with completely understanding. He's figured Gulaal is tying herself down with her past, but he hasn't figured why she's continuously misunderstanding him and his feelings - he hasn't figured that she is in fact pulling off a Kesar on him, by posing this shield in between because she knows if she doesn't he will get through in the blinking of an eye! He doesn't understand how his power to reach through to her past, and open up a brand new present and future is scaring her like no tomorrow ... he doesn't understand that even when she's posing to treat him like a kid, his presence around her makes her nervous - not out attraction yet, maybe (or maybe even that without knowing) but out of how overwhelmingly he can affect her when she's fighting him with all her might. He doesn't understand she left the house not because she was mad at him, but because he was beginning to scare her.

Its exactly the way he was - when he wanted to hold himself away from her, and every chance that she made him forget about his hatred and grudges, he would retrospect over and struggle to hold together the shaky walls.

Basically - Kesar is understanding her resistance, even her reasons now - but he still hasn't figured her fear element. He still hasn't figured how when she said she was alone before with Vasant and she's alone now with him - it was because she was a little lost girl, and unlike him, she wasn't at a liberty to expose that side.

Btw - I'm not defending Gulaal. Little lost girl or not - she's turning blinds on the truth, and that is wrong. Period. She's not taking accountability of her own actions and decisions - for which no one but Gulaal was responsible - and that is wrong.
But I am saying, that Kesar still has to figure that last mystery about her fear. He might, tonight - when she takes care of him ☺️
